So, now you've staged homephotos, and a luxury real estate agent. It is time to reach out to buyers. Apart from the MLS, along with the agent's site, where are those buyers currently likely to come from? When placing an ad Realtors and sellers will need to decide which publication will reach out to the qualified buyers for their price point. Is a person seeking to spend $1,000,000+ on a home going to find that land from a book in a box next to the grocery store? Probably not.
